On 06/22/2012 11:00 PM, Daniel Santos wrote: > Theory of Operation > =================== > Historically, genericity in C meant function pointers, the overhead of a > function call and the inability of the compiler to optimize code across > the function call boundary. GCC has been getting better and better at > optimization and determining when a value is a compile-time constant and > compiling it out. As of gcc 4.6, it has finally reached a point where > it's possible to have generic search & insert cores that optimize > exactly as well as if they were hand-coded. (see also gcc man page: > -findirect-inlining)
For those of us who stopped upgrading gcc when it went to a non-open license, and the people trying to escape to llvm/pcc/open64/tcc/qcc/etc and build the kernel with that, this will simply be "less optimized" rather than "you're SOL, hail stallman"?
> Layer 2: Type-Safety > -------------------- > In order to achieve type-safety of a generic interface in C, we must > delve deep into the darkened Swamps of The Preprocessor and confront the > Prince of Darkness himself: Big Ugly Macro. To be fair, there is an > alternative solution (discussed in History & Design Goals), the > so-called "x-macro" or "supermacro" where you #define some pre-processor > values and include an unguarded header file. With 17 parameters, I > choose this solution for its ease of use and brevity, but it's an area > worth debate.
